Embarking Across Borders: A Deep Dive into International ETFs
Investors seeking to diversify their portfolios often explore international markets. Exchange-Traded Funds (ETFs) offer a efficient way to gain in these global opportunities. International ETFs provide exposure to a basket of securities from various countries or regions, enabling investors to mitigate risk and potentially maximize returns. Selecting the right international ETF involves analyzing factors such as investment objectives, fee structure, and underlying assets.
- Investigating different ETFs is essential to make an informed choice.
- Asset allocation remains a key principle for successful investing in international markets.
Remember that international investments involve certain risks, such as currency fluctuations and economic instability. Advising with a financial advisor can provide valuable recommendations for navigating these complexities.
